As long as your agreement fulfills California's legal requirements, the courts will consider it valid no matter how long you have been married. In fact, postnuptial agreements are most common among couples who have been married for years, as they understand better how much each party has to gain or lose.
Georgia Requirements for Postnuptial Agreements One spouse cannot be coerced or threatened into signing a postnuptial agreement. There must be full and fair disclosure for a postnuptial agreement to be valid. This means that all assets, liabilities, and income from both parties must be disclosed to the other.
A postnuptial agreement can create rules for many different things should the couple divorce. Asset and property division. Investments. Inheritance. Premarital assets. Debts. Retirement and 401(k) accounts. Child custody and child support. Alimony or spousal support.
How to Create a Postnuptial Agreement That's Enforceable The document must be in writing and notarized. The document must be signed voluntarily and intentionally by both parties. Both parties must make a full and fair disclosure of all their assets, debts, property, and income.
It is created after a couple is married to define the rights and obligations of both partners if they were to separate or divorce. While it is entirely possible to construct your own postnuptial agreement, it is not typically recommended.
